- Decision on a request for documents regarding the distinction between entrepreneur status for VAT and income tax, including the consequences of this distinction
- Request made under the Law on Open Government (Woo)
- Requested documents include policy documents, analysis, implementation procedures, case descriptions, legal analyses, and statistics
- Decision made to disclose the requested information, as long as it is available and not already public
